I picked up my F Body LS from a good friend, and is already built, but I decided to freshen up a few things before the season starts.

Engine Specs.
MS4 Camshaft
Texas Speed Valve train (springs, pushrods etc)
Speed pro forged pistons
LS6 Intake manifold
ARP everything haha..
Fidanza Lightweight flywheel
Sikky Trans mount
Sikky Driveshaft
Sikky Headers
Canton Racing Oil pan
Custom engine mounts
Tuned ECU
and a fully built T56

yes, ive had those blow off my fuel filter. luckily it was mounted under the car and not in the engine bay. i just lost power and pulled to the side of the road.
another thing, flip the fuel rail around so the feed is on same side as filter.
